Steelers quarterback Russell Wilson gets to experience his first Pittsburgh/Baltimore rivalry game this Sunday. Could it be the first of many more?
Talking to Hannah Storm on ESPN, Wilson said he wants to play in the NFL longer than you may think.
“I definitely want to play another five to seven more years,” said Wilson. “I think that’s always been my goal, I’ve been very clear about that since the beginning.”
Other than the calf injury that kept him out the first six games of the season, Wilson has been relatively healthy during his decade-plus NFL career.
“I feel great, I feel young, I feel I can still move around out there and make all the decisions and all the throws,” said Wilson.
But even though he expects to play into his 40s, his focus is on the Baltimore Ravens.
“My focus in here, right now is winning this week and then hopefully winning the next one and the one after that and the one after that and then you get the end of the season, hopefully you’re holding something that we’ll forever remember,” added Wilson. “I had a goal of winning a couple more and that’s why I came [to Pittsburgh].”
After it seemed like Wilson would be here for only one season, it looks like there will be more quarterback questions at the end of the season, if Russ continues to play well.
